Send us Fan MailNow this is just but a thought and I am speaking on it because maybe the point isn’t so much about a flying mountain as it is about staying open to the many, many, many options that God has for explaining what He means in His word. And so but I will present the case and point scripture without telling you what I saw or thought in my reading of it until later. I am including it because it is the trigger scripture for the entire message:So speaking of His word let’s get it:Matthew 17:14-21 - 14 And when they had come to the multitude, a man came to Him, kneeling down to Him and saying, 15 “Lord, have mercy on my son, for he is an epileptic and suffers severely; for he often falls into the fire and often into the water. 16 So I brought him to Your disciples, but they could not cure him.”17 Then Jesus answered and said, “O faithless and perverse generation, how long shall I be with you? How long shall I bear with you? Bring him here to Me.” 18 And Jesus rebuked the demon, and it came out of him; and the child was cured from that very hour.19 Then the disciples came to Jesus privately and said, “Why could we not cast it out?”20 So Jesus said to them, “Because of your unbelief; for assuredly, I say to you, if you have faith as a mustard seed, you will say to this mountain, ‘Move from here to there,’ and it will move; and nothing will be impossible for you. 21 However, this kind does not go out except by prayer and fasting.”My thought specifically in this verse is that a mountain can represent a powerful demon. If not why would Jesus depart from talking about a demon and then talking about a mountain and then talking about prayer and fasting. Matthew 12:45 - 45 Then he goes and takes with him seven other spirits more wicked than himself, and they enter and dwell there; and the last state of that man is worse than the first. So shall it also be with this wicked generation.”Seven More Spirits: The spirit then goes out and brings seven other spirits that are more wicked than itself to live inside the person.The following are instructions for us to engage the demonic· Mark 16:17: "And these signs will accompany those who believe: in my name they will cast out demons..." – Jesus states that driving out evil spirits is a sign following believers. · Matthew 10:1: Jesus gave His twelve disciples "authority over impure spirits to drive them out" and heal every disease. · Luke 10:17: The seventy-two followers returned with joy, saying, "Lord, even the demons are subject to us in your name!" · Mark 9:29: Jesus said, "This kind cannot be driven out by anything but prayer." · Acts 16:18: Paul commanded a spirit to leave a person, saying, "In the name of Jesus Christ I command you to come out of her!"
